Witness and Proclamation is a "Ministry Team." Ministry Teams conduct and coordinate program ministries in the Association in cooperation with the Cabinet.
The Witness and Proclamation Team shall include no less than twelve (12) members [four (4) of whom shall be two (2) lay and two (2) authorized ministers from each Region]. They shall work in collaboration with and on behalf of the Regions to help each individual and church live faithfully in the world. We rejoice that many Northwest Ohio Association Churches have made great progress in making facilities more accessible and your
organization more inclusive.
Since 1978, when Tom Payton, missionary from Japan, spent a year in the Ohio Conference as a visiting missionary, the legacy of his ministry has helped us become more aware of the need for accessibility, and how the church in Japan has addressed this. Since then
Association and the Ohio Conference with the United Church of Christ has been challenging its member congregations and institutions to
accept the opportunity and the responsibility for fuller ministries with
persons with disabilities. It is our hope that the audit will encourage a group in your congregation or institution to become more aware of your attitudinal, communication and architectural barriers.
